Dear Maintainer,

As configured in the package, automatic login (AUTOLOGIN=true) fails
with "Authentication failure".

The following fixes the problem:

1. Using the PAM configuration recommended for Debian, available at
https://github.com/tvrzna/emptty/blob/master/res/pam-debian

2. Adding the user to the nopasswdlogin group (as described in the
README of emptty).

Suggested fix:

1. replace the PAM file in the package with the one above,

2. have README.Debian mention that the user should create the
nopasswdlogin group and then add the autologin user.

Bug#333803: removing package should remove /etc/cron.d/postgresql-common

2005-10-13 Thread Tamas K Papp
Package: postgresql-common
Version: 26
Severity: normal


if the file above is not removed from the cron.d, the cron daemon will
send error messages like

/bin/sh: /usr/sbin/pg_maintenance: No such file or directory

Purging the package of course fixes the problem, but plain remove
should also delete this file.
